Estrogen and cortisol*
Hormonal imbalance, including high levels of estrogen and cortisol, can hinder fat loss efforts. Estrogen dominance and chronically high cortisol levels promote fat storage, especially around the abdominal area. Adopting lifestyle changes to reduce estrogen and cortisol levels is crucial to improving fat burning.
How to reduce insulin levels
To reduce insulin levels, eat a balanced diet rich in whole foods, lean proteins,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ates. Incorporating regular physical activity, such as strength training and high-intensity interval training (HIIT), can also improve insulin sensitivity and promote fat burning.
How to reduce estrogen and cortisol
Reducing estrogen and cortisol levels involves implementing stress reduction techniques such as meditation, yoga, adequate sleep, and relaxation exercises. Additionally, eating estrogen-balancing foods like cruciferous vegetables and managing stress effectively can help restore hormonal balance and facilitate fat loss.
Fat-burning hormones**
Several hormones play an important role in regulating metabolism and fat burning. Hormones such as adrenaline, growth hormone and thyroid hormones stimulate lipolysis, the breakdown of fat for energy. Strategies such as intermittent fasting and optimizing sleep quality can improve the secretion of fat-burning hormones and accelerate weight loss.
Exercise and weight loss
Regular exercise is essential to achieving and maintaining weight loss. Combining cardiovascular exercise, strength training and flexibility exercises can maximize calorie expenditure and boost metabolism.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ity exercise per week for optimal fat-burning results.
